      Description
      • The IL10RA gene encodes the alpha subunit of the interleukin-10 receptor, a key mediator of IL-10–dependent anti-inflammatory signaling and immune tolerance. Defects in IL10RA are associated with very-early-onset colitis and immune regulatory disorders. The IL2RG gene encodes the common gamma chain, an essential component shared by the receptors for IL-2, IL-4, IL-7, IL-9, IL-15, and IL-21. It is indispensable for the development and function of T cells, B cells, and NK cells, and mutations in IL2RG are the primary cause of X-linked severe combined immunodeficiency (X-SCID).
      • The exons 1-5 and part of exon 6 of mouse Il10ra gene that encode signal peptide, extracellular domain, transmembrane domain, and part of cytoplasmic region are replaced by human counterparts in B-hIL10RA/hIL2RG mice. The promoter, 5’UTR and 3’UTR region of the mouse gene are retained. The human IL10RA expression is driven by endogenous mouse Il10ra promoter, while mouse Il10ra gene transcription and translation will be disrupted. The exons 1-8 of mouse Il2rg gene that encode the whole molecule (ATG to STOP codon) are replaced by human counterparts in B-hIL10RA/hIL2RG mice. The promoter, 3’UTR and 5’UTR region of the mouse gene are retained. The human IL2RG expression is driven by endogenous mouse Il2rg promoter, while mouse Il2rg gene transcription and translation will be disrupted.
      • B-hIL10RA/hIL2RG mice were derived from mating B-hIL10RA mice(110083) and B-hIL2RG mice(110087). Human IL10RA was detectable in peritoneal macrophages of B-hIL10RA/hIL2RG mice. Human IL2RG was detectable on T cells and NK cells from spleen of B-hIL10RA/hIL2RG mice.

      Protein expression analysis in peritoneal macrophages

      IL10RA expression analysis in wild-type mice and homozygous humanized B-hIL10RA/hIL2RG mice by flow cytometry. Peritoneal macrophages were collected from C57BL/6JNifdc mice (+/+) (Female, 6-week-old, n=1) and B-hIL10RA/hIL2RG mice (H/H) (Female, 6-week-old, n=1). Protein expression was analyzed with anti-IL10RA antibody (Biolegend, 308811; Biolegend, 112705) by flow cytometry. Human IL10RA was detected in homozygous B-hIL10RA/hIL2RG mice.

      Protein expression analysis in spleen T cells and NK cells

      IL2RG expression analysis in wild-type mice and homozygous B-hIL10RA/hIL2RG mice by flow cytometry. Spleen T cells and NK cells were collected from C57BL/6JNifdc mice (+/+) (Female, 9-week-old, n=2; Male, 9-week-old, n=2) and B-hIL10RA/hIL2RG mice (H/H) (Female, 9-week-old, n=2; Male, 9-week-old, n=2). Protein expression was analyzed with anti-IL2RG antibody (Biolegend, 132308; Biolegend, 338606) by flow cytometry. Human IL2RG was detected in homozygous B-hIL10RA/hIL2RG mice.
